Which zones grow Sugar Pie Pumpkin best?

Sugar Pie Pumpkin is a squash variety rated for zone 3 and warmer (frost-free). In colder zones, start seeds indoors earlier and use a longer-season plan; in very hot zones (9+), pick the cooler fall window. The ZIP tool below gives the exact answer for your neighborhood.

Cool edge (zone 3)
Start indoors ~8 weeks before last frost; transplant after soil warms; expect a shorter, later harvest.
Sweet spot (zone 68)
Full season; sow per the calendar and harvest at the catalog 100-day target.
Hot edge (zone 10+)
Heat may slow fruiting — favor early planting or a fall crop; shade in peak summer.
